Is there a book with osteopathic med school information that is similar to the allopathic med school MSAR? I have a thin orange one called "Osteopathic Medical College Information Book" but it doesn't have nearly as much information. I got it from some AACOM reps at a med school fair at my university, who said this was all they had, but I thought I read somewhere else that there is a better book.

Hi, doinmybest5840,

If there is an official MSAR-analog for osteopathic medical schools, I have yet to see it. You might find some analogous information from Princeton Review or Kaplan, or other similar companies. I believe that USN&WR also has some selected statistics. That being said, I actually took the liberty of compiling a few links from a variety of sources, including the AACOM, that can probably get you started in the direction of finding various official and unofficial statistics on Osteopathic Medical Schools. Taken together, they can probably provide you with quite a lot of useful information. Check it out here:
